At Fastbreak AI, we’re reimagining sports operations and creating the sports industry's most advanced AI software platform. We’re looking for an outstanding Product Designer skilled in UX and UI design to join our product design team. If you thrive in fast-growth settings, prefer working with small teams and have designed products that are beautiful and easy to use, this is your shot to join our roster.

This is an onsite job, working from our Charlotte, NC headquarters.

What You’ll Do

  • Lead Product Design: Drive the full product design process, from discovery to delivery.
  • User Research: Conduct in-depth user research with tournament operators, event directors, and participants to identify key user needs and challenges. Leverage user feedback and analytics to refine the platform’s features, improving both operator efficiency and user satisfaction.
  • UX Design: Develop wireframes, prototypes, and high-fidelity designs that reflect a user-first approach and align with business goals.
  • Interaction Design: Design intuitive navigation and interaction patterns tailored for tournament operators managing complex workflows.
  • Usability Testing: Plan and conduct usability testing to gather feedback, iterating designs to ensure they meet user expectations.
  • Design System Development: Maintain and improve a scalable design system to ensure consistency across web and future mobile interfaces.
  • Front-End Development Collaboration: Use AI-assisted tools like Cursor to generate and refine front-end code (HTML, CSS, JavaScript), ensuring seamless translation of design to implementation while working closely with engineering.

Requirements

  • Experience: 3+ years of experience in UX design, with a portfolio showcasing successful web-based SaaS projects. Mobile design experience is a plus.
  • Skills: Expertise in Figma, Cursor and Adobe Creative Suite; proficiency with other prototyping and user testing tools.
  • Knowledge: Strong understanding of user-centered design principles, interaction design, and usability best practices.
  • Research: Demonstrated ability to conduct qualitative and quantitative user research.
  • Communication: Exceptional collaboration and communication skills for working with cross-functional teams and stakeholders.
  • Domain Expertise: Familiarity with tournament operations, sports event management, or sports technology is highly desirable.
  • Problem-Solving: You're an analytical thinker with a keen eye for detail, and the ability to translate complex workflows into intuitive designs.
